Symptoms

  • •Battery warning light illuminated on the dashboard
  • •Difficulty starting the vehicle after periods of inactivity
  • •Electrical components (e.g., lights, infotainment system) remain powered when the vehicle is off
  • •Frequent need to jump-start the vehicle
  • •Short lifespan of the battery despite regular replacement

Solution
1. Preparation
  • Gather necessary tools and materials.
  • Disconnect the negative battery terminal using a socket set.
  • Ensure the vehicle is in a safe, well-ventilated area.
2. Check and Repair Parasitic Draw
  • Sub-steps:
    • Set the multimeter to the amperage setting and connect it in series between the negative battery terminal and the negative battery cable.
    • Allow the vehicle to go to sleep (usually takes about 30 minutes) and then check the reading on the multimeter.
    • If the reading is above 50 milliamps, you have a parasitic draw.
    • Identify the circuit causing the draw by removing fuses one at a time and monitoring the multimeter reading.
3. Inspect and Clean Battery Connections
  • Sub-steps:
    • Remove the battery terminals completely.
    • Clean any corrosion on the terminals and battery posts using a wire brush and a mixture of baking soda and water.
    • Reattach the terminals and ensure they are tightened securely.
4. Verify Alternator Functionality
  • Sub-steps:
    • Reconnect the battery and start the engine.
    • Use a multimeter to check the voltage at the battery terminals; it should read between 13.7 and 14.7 volts.
    • If the voltage is below this range, the alternator may be faulty and require replacement.
5. Replace Faulty Components
  • Sub-steps:
    • If an electrical component is identified as the source of the parasitic draw, replace or repair it as necessary.
    • For example, if the alarm system is malfunctioning, consult the vehicle's service manual for specific procedures.
